Glenora Ferry out of service June 17

Users of the Glenora Ferry between Prince Edward County and Adolphustown may need to make other arrangements on Monday, June 17th, 2024.  The Glenora Ferry will be out of service on Monday, June 17th from 10am until 3pm. The closure is to allow for work to be completed on the Glenora ramp. ...
